The story that haunts this land

Your investigation begins at Coral Gables City Hall, a 120-foot-tall edifice designed by Denman Fink and inaugurated on April 23, 1932, by George Merrick. This structure, located at 405 Biltmore Way, is a central point for understanding the ambition of 'Coral Gables - The City Beautiful'. The city hall's archives, built between 1931 and 1932, contain clues about the city's early developments, and every detail of its Mediterranean Revival architecture may conceal a lead to the lost blueprint. It is here that the founder of Coral Gables envisioned the soul of his creation, a future National Historic Landmark.

Heading west, 0.8 km from City Hall, you reach the Biltmore Hotel at 1200 Anastasia Avenue. Opened on February 15, 1926, this 315-foot-tall, 15-story hotel was Florida's tallest building until 1928. Developed by George Merrick, it is a cornerstone of Coral Gables and even served as a military hospital from 1942 to 1945 during World War II. Designated a National Historic Landmark in 1985, the Biltmore Hotel symbolizes Merrick's opulence and vision. Its vast corridors and period rooms could hold forgotten documents or symbols related to the city's initial plan.

Your journey then takes you to the Venetian Pool, 1.2 km from City Hall. Opened on June 21, 1924, this historic public pool, also designated a National Historic Landmark in 2000, was created by George Merrick from an old coral rock quarry. With its 120 x 82 foot water surface and 30-foot-high waterfall, it embodies the ingenuity of the landscape design envisioned by Merrick and Frank Button. The carved coral grottoes and alcoves might hide messages left by the builders or maps detailing the location of future Coral Gables constructions, a major Florida tourist site.

You continue your exploration towards Douglas Entrance, a monumental 40-foot-high arch designed by Phineas Paist and adorned with sculptures by Denman Fink. Built in 1925-1926, 1 km from City Hall, it marks the historic northern entrance to Coral Gables from Douglas Road. With its Corinthian columns and Mediterranean motifs, this edifice is not just a gate, but a symbol of the 'City Beautiful'. George Merrick intended every entrance to his city to be a work of art, and it is possible that crucial clues for the lost blueprint are etched or hidden within these historic stones of Coral Gables.

Finally, your quest leads you to Miracle Mile, a main avenue in Coral Gables (Coral Way, 3300-4000 blocks) developed by George Merrick between 1921 and 1925. This approximately 1.6 km long street, lined with arcades and Mediterranean buildings, is a historic commercial artery, named 'Miracle Mile' in 1957 for its post-Depression success. 0.5 km from City Hall, it is the ideal place to reassemble the blueprint fragments. The facades of over 150 shops and inscriptions could reveal Merrick's last secret. You will have thus explored the Coral Gables Historic District, a living testament to Mediterranean Revival Architecture and the George Merrick Legacy, a true gem of Florida Historical Sites.

1912
George Merrick inherits the family lands, laying the groundwork for Coral Gables.
1925
Coral Gables is officially incorporated at the peak of the Florida land boom.
1929
The 1929 stock market crash ends the boom and plunges Merrick into financial hardship.
